Abstract

Results of SCCC MO calculations for the dimeric oxygen double-bridged [Mo2O4Cl4(H2O)2]2−ion are reported. On the basis of these results the previously reported spectra and magnetic properties may be explained. The strong direct molybdenum — molybdenum interaction in the Mo2O 2+4 core was proved to exist.
